New partnership in waste pile management solutions


Ashtead Technology has been appointed as the exclusive distributor in the UK and Ireland for two innovative products that help waste managers improve composting effi ciency; prevent waste fi res; avoid odour complaints; protect the environment, and comply with the latest regulations.


Developed by Freeland Scientifi c, ‘CompostManager’ is a complete system for managing the composting process, and ‘smarTprobe’ is a temperature monitoring system for compost and other wastes where overheating and fi re represent a potential hazard. Both systems employ the Best Available Techniques (BAT) required by the Environment Agency.


CompostManager consists of a portable probe and measurement system that records the key factors affecting composting effi ciency: temperature, moisture, oxygen and carbon dioxide. Collected data is uploaded to a website which provides suggested management instructions such as ‘Turn’, ‘Irrigate’ and ‘Leave Alone.’


The smarTprobe system consists of robust temperature probes that are inserted into piles of bulk materials that have the potential to catch fi re. A colour-coded display enables users to check the temperature profi les of their waste piles, and the system automatically issues warnings before dangerous conditions arise. With around 300 signifi cant fi res at waste sites every year, the potential for the smarTprobe system is enormous if these fi res are to be prevented.

OTT HydroMet has launched a new all-in-one wireless water level logger that can be used for the remote monitoring of surface or groundwater. Simple to set up and run with a mobile phone, the OTT ecoLog 1000 has been designed for long-term applications, even in remote locations, and is able to issue warnings automatically to help manage or avoid the problematic conditions that can occur when water levels rise.


“Our customers are already walking around with an incredible piece of technology in their pockets,” comments OTT’s UK managing director Nigel Grimsley. “So it makes sense to exploit the value of this by developing an App that can be used to set up, manage and view data, and by designing a water level monitor that communicates wirelessly with a mobile phone or tablet.”


The App runs on mobile devices supporting iOS, Android, Mac, and Windows 10, and with integrated Bluetooth Low Energy (BLE) communication, the ecoLog 1000 can pair with a mobile device up to 10 metres away, which signifi cantly enhances simplicity and onsite safety. Further enhancements to onsite operations include the ability to quickly change batteries, and even shorten cable lengths if necessary.


An on-board SIM card enables the monitor to feed data to secure servers, and users are provided with password protected access to the readings via the App. However, in addition to viewing and downloading data, the App also enables users to manage the ecoLog’s confi guration remotely.


For monitoring network operators, a further App- based solution, HydroMet Cloud, offers web-based data visualisation of live monitoring data in user- defi ned maps, graphs, tables etc.


With a rugged stainless steel probe (also suitable for brackish and saline water) and a very stable ceramic pressure cell, the ecoLog 1000 is designed for challenging applications. Data are encrypted with automatic retries if transmission fails, so users can expect continuous data streams with alerts when water approaches user-set threshold levels.


Commenting on the applications for the instrument, Nigel says: “A wide range of people would benefi t from remote water level data and alerts; these include government agencies, fl ood managers, local communities, highway managers, rail network operators, water companies and water resource managers, as well as consultants, academics and environmental researchers.


“For all of these groups, easy access to remote data will save a great deal of time and money by preventing unnecessary site visits, and the provision of water level alarms will facilitate the instigation of timely mitigation measures.”

Construction demolition and earthworks have the potential to release large amounts of dust into the air, which can have a signifi cant impact on the local air quality. These events need to be measured accurately so as to ensure mitigation measures are performing effectively. Often construction takes place close to household residents or ecologically sensitive areas giving rise to the need for real-time monitoring. If an area already has a problem with high levels of PM10 or PM2.5 then it will almost certainly need an air quality monitoring scheme/plan to measure the dust emissions released into the local air.


Having the ability to accurately measure PM10 and PM2.5 in real-time whilst capturing and making that data readily available to other users is fast becoming the norm. Giving access to multiple stakeholders via a cloud analytics platform enables construction site operators to keep everyone informed about the performance of the dust management controls in place.


When choosing an environmental dust monitor for a construction site make sure that it has been certifi ed by the Environment Agency under its MCERTS scheme for indicative ambient particulate monitors. It’s also important to check the concentration level that is has been tested to; as a minimum this should be equal to or greater than 190 µg/m3


. In


addition to this, make sure that the monitor has been tested to measure both PM10 and PM2.5 simultaneously. Always ask to see a copy of the co-location test results and choose the monitor that has the highest correlation to the reference instrument.
